12. Leverage Airline Mistakes to Your Advantage

Mistakes happen—even in the airline industry. If you notice a booking error, such as being assigned a seat that doesn’t match what you paid for or finding that your meal preference wasn’t recorded, you may have an opportunity to request an upgrade as compensation. Similarly, if the airline involuntarily downgrades your seat due to an overbooked flight or an equipment swap, insist on a fair resolution—sometimes, that means getting bumped up rather than just receiving a voucher. Always remain calm and polite, as the way you present your case matters. Pro Tip: If you’re assigned a seat next to a broken entertainment system or a malfunctioning seat, discreetly mention it to the crew and ask if any “alternative seating” is available. They may offer you a spot in a better cabin if space permits.
